Spray it Don’t Say it. Spray Paint Leather That Is.
Spray it Don't Say it. Spray Paint Leather that is. Did you know you can spray paint leather??? This Silver Chair once resided in a woman's house who sadly, smoked three packs of cigarettes a day, for at least 30 years, as long as she lived in the house, with the windows shut! My neighbor gave them to me, when said aunt passed away. I diligently cleaned with almost a gallon of TSP (not joking), and then the process began. I Painted the frame in a lovely Antique White, then glazed with a mix of Glaze and Coffee Bean Craft Paint. The Upholstery got a makeover with Paint! Yes, you can spray paint Leather, just go really, really slowly. As in, ONE LIGHT COAT at a time, and build up to ...
